Responding to a child coming out as gay
When a child comes out as gay, it is important to listen openly and accept their feelings without arguing or dismissing them. Parents should strive to stay connected and seek support from their church community. It is crucial to differentiate between acceptance and approval, understanding that accepting a child's feelings does not mean approving of their actions. Parents should be mindful of cultural pressures and protect their children from harmful influences.
